Ticket #— Floor 9 Opening Prep, Brindlemoor House

Hi facilities folks, Floor 9 opens to staff next Monday and we need a few things squared away before then. Lift access is live, but the two side doors by the kitchenette are still on the old lock config — please reprogram them before Friday. Also, signage for the quiet rooms hasn't arrived, so pop up the temporary printed ones for now. Until the badge readers sync, the interim door code for Floor 9 is below.

door code, bajop-bajog: bdg-DSWAC-43621

// READ_REPLICA_LAG_ALARM_MS
// Heads up, plugin authors: if replica lag on the Tottlebury cluster
// exceeds this threshold, the Quorra bus starts serving stale reads and
// your hooks may fire with outdated rows. Don't lower this in your own
// config — you'll just drown in false alarms. The value was tuned
// against the build referenced below.

session token of tajef-bageg = htk21_5d90d574934f3ccae6437

## TideGlass Widget — Interpolation Pass

For this week's sync: the TideGlass widget now interpolates between harmonic station readings rather than snapping to the nearest hour, which removes the visible stair-stepping on the Port Venlow demo. Cache invalidation follows the station's refresh window, and stale frames fade rather than flicker. The tuning constants governing interpolation width and fade timing are as follows.

tuning constants:
QUOTAS = {
    "druwyn": 5,
    "holix": 5,
    "zorath": 5,
    "holwyn": 10,
}